
2020 School Board elections in Cass County, Indiana
Last Updated on September 24, 2020 by Cass County Online
We’ve compiled information about the school board seats that will be on the ballot for the November 2020 General Election.
School board members are nonpartisan and are elected to a four-year term.
The school board seats that will be on the ballot in Cass County in the fall are listed below.
